t1testpage - create a PostScript proof for a Type 1 font
t1testpage
[font]
T1testpage creates a PostScript proof document for the
specified Type 1 font file and writes it to the standard output. The proof
shows every glyph in the font, including its glyph name and encoding. The
font argument should be the name of a PFA or PFB font file. If it is omitted,
t1testpage will read a font file from the standard input.
T1testpage is
preliminary software.
- -o file, --output=file
- Write the output proof
to file instead of the standard output.
- -h, --help
- Print usage information
and exit.
- -v, --version
- Print the version number and some short non-warranty
information and exit.
